Maharashtra CM Fadnavis Drives G-Wagen at Mumbai-Pune Expressway Missing Link Inauguration

Maharashtra CM Devendra Fadnavis inaugurated the Mumbai-Pune Expressway's 19.8 km 'missing link' on Friday, driving a G-Wagen SUV along the new stretch. The Rs 6,700 crore project includes a 182-metre cable-stayed bridge and is expected to cut travel time by 25-30 minutes while generating Rs 70,000 crore in economic activity. The inauguration coincided with Maharashtra Day but caused massive traffic congestion.

South Korea Faces Major Traffic Congestion as Extended Holiday Begins

South Korea experienced severe traffic congestion on Friday as the first day of an extended holiday began, following the government's designation of Labor Day as a national holiday. With up to five consecutive days off including Children's Day on Tuesday, more than 6 million vehicles traveled nationwide, with drives to Busan taking up to 9 hours and 10 minutes. Approximately 1.3 million people were also estimated to pass through Incheon International Airport during the holiday period.

How Women Leaders Are Transforming Cities for Everyone

This opinion piece argues that female city leaders are driving unprecedented urban transformation toward more inclusive, sustainable cities. Drawing on examples from Barcelona's Ada Colau, Montréal's Valérie Plante and Paris's Anne Hidalgo, the authors contend that women leaders' lived experiences result in policies benefiting vulnerable groups. The article cites statistics showing only 25 of the world's 300 largest cities have female mayors, and calls for more gender balance in municipal leadership to create public spaces that work for everyone.
